One of the standout benefits of text-to-speech (TTS) technology is its remarkable ability to enhance accessibility for individuals with disabilities. I have a vivid memory of my childhood friend Jamie, who faced significant challenges due to her dyslexia. Reading for her was often a frustrating ordeal, holding her back in school. Then, when she discovered TTS tools, it was like the fog lifted. Suddenly, instead of struggling through the text, she could hear the words being spoken aloud, transforming her learning experience. TTS technology provides a voice to written content, enabling those who find reading challenging to engage with information effortlessly. Whether it’s a student with learning disabilities or an elderly person grappling with vision impairment, TTS opens up pathways to knowledge. I’ve witnessed friends using these tools for everything from catching up on emails to digesting dense textbooks. It’s truly empowering to see how this technology enriches lives, allowing people to participate more fully in various endeavors.
